Nestled in the Leutasch Valley, this charming alpine village offers spectacular hiking trails and cross-country skiing routes through pristine meadows. Visit the Leutascher Geisterklamm 'Spirit Gorge' nearby, where wooden walkways lead you above rushing waters and through dramatic rock formations.

The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-4°C. The rainiest months in Weidach are June, August, July and May, with each month seeing an average of 238 mm of rainfall.
